Biography

Alex Andreas, a multifaceted individual, embarked on a journey in the entertainment industry before formal training at the prestigious London School of Musical Theatre (LSMT). Prior to his formal education, he worked as a bodyguard for renowned artists such as The Gap Band and Eurhythmics, among others.

Following his time at LSMT, Alex Andreas landed the coveted role of the Big Bopper in the critically acclaimed musical The Buddy Holly Story. He toured extensively throughout the United Kingdom, Germany, Denmark, and even had the privilege of performing at Prince Renoirs club in Monte Carlo, a testament to his exceptional talent.

Alex Andreas' impressive resume also includes work in film and television, where he collaborated with esteemed actors such as Brad Pitt, Jason Statham, and Guy Richie in the hit film Snatch. His television credits include the BBC comedy series My Hero, starring Ardle O'Hanlon, and the Channel 4 show Make My Day, featuring Mark Owen from the iconic boyband Take That.
